ANUTIN: FARANGS WHO DON’T WEAR MASK ‘SHOULD BE KICKED OUT’

Featured Replies

 Health minister Anutin Charnvirakul on Friday slammed foreign tourists who refused to wear face masks handed out by the government, saying they “should be kicked out.”

Using racially charged terms in an interview with the media at BTS Siam this morning, the health minister also said non-compliant behaviors of foreigners should be reported to embassies.
